Podcast Overview

The NECA Innovation Overload Podcast helps contractors make sense of industry tools and decide what is right for their business. Each week, the NECA Innovation Team and a weekly guest discuss and tackle problems contractors across the country are facing.

#129: Jesse Chapman

In this episode of Innovation Overload, Jesse Chapman, Chief Operating Officer of VECA Electric & Technologies, shares why contractors need a clear goal when pursuing innovation, especially when results take time. Drawing on VECA’s experience advancing VDC and prefabrication, Jesse explains how keeping the end goal in focus can help teams push through challenges and make progress without expecting immediate cost savings.
